Home
last modified time | relevance | path

Searched refs:memberList (Results 1 - 9 of 9) sorted by relevance

/third_party/glslang/glslang/MachineIndependent/
H A DlinkValidate.cpp594 TTypeList* memberList = block->getType().getWritableStruct(); in mergeBlockDefinitions() local
601 size_t memberListStartSize = memberList->size(); in mergeBlockDefinitions()
605 if ((*memberList)[j].type->getFieldName() == (*unitMemberList)[i].type->getFieldName()) { in mergeBlockDefinitions()
607 const TType* memberType = (*memberList)[j].type; in mergeBlockDefinitions()
624 memberList->push_back((*unitMemberList)[i]); in mergeBlockDefinitions()
625 memberIndexUpdates[i] = (unsigned int)memberList->size() - 1; in mergeBlockDefinitions()
698 (*unitMemberList) = (*memberList); in mergeBlockDefinitions()
2154 const TTypeList& memberList = *type.getStruct(); in getBaseAlignment() local
2158 for (size_t m = 0; m < memberList.size(); ++m) { in getBaseAlignment()
2161 TLayoutMatrix subMatrixLayout = memberList[ in getBaseAlignment()
2248 const TTypeList& memberList = *type.getStruct(); getScalarAlignment() local
2323 const TTypeList& memberList = *type.getStruct(); getOffset() local
2347 const TTypeList& memberList = *blockType.getStruct(); getBlockSize() local
[all...]
H A Dreflection.cpp172 const TTypeList& memberList = *type.getStruct(); in getOffsets() local
178 if (memberList[m].type->getQualifier().hasOffset()) in getOffsets()
179 offset = memberList[m].type->getQualifier().layoutOffset; in getOffsets()
182 intermediate.updateOffset(type, *memberList[m].type, offset, memberSize); in getOffsets()
222 const TTypeList &memberList = *parentType.getStruct(); in countAggregateMembers() local
226 for (size_t i = 0; i < memberList.size(); i++) in countAggregateMembers()
228 const TType &memberType = *memberList[i].type; in countAggregateMembers()
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/
H A Dglslang_wrapper_utils.cpp1442 spirv::IdRefList *memberList,
1481 spirv::IdRefList *memberList,
1493 memberList->resize(memberCount);
1495 spirv::WriteTypeStruct(blobOut, id, *memberList);
3563 spirv::IdRefList memberList;
3564 ParseTypeStruct(instruction, &id, &memberList);
3566 return mPerVertexTrimmer.transformTypeStruct(mIds, id, &memberList, mSpirvBlobOut);
/third_party/glslang/glslang/Include/
H A DTypes.h1649 const TTypeList& memberList = *type.getStruct(); in TType() local
1650 shallowCopy(*memberList[derefIndex].type); in TType()
/third_party/skia/third_party/externals/angle2/src/common/spirv/
H A Dspirv_instruction_builder_autogen.h81 void WriteTypeStruct(Blob *blob, IdResult idResult, const IdRefList &memberList);
H A Dspirv_instruction_parser_autogen.h94 void ParseTypeStruct(const uint32_t *_instruction, IdResult *idResult, IdRefList *memberList);
H A Dspirv_instruction_parser_autogen.cpp392 void ParseTypeStruct(const uint32_t *_instruction, IdResult *idResult, IdRefList *memberList) in ParseTypeStruct() argument
400 if (memberList) in ParseTypeStruct()
404 memberList->emplace_back(_instruction[_o++]); in ParseTypeStruct()
H A Dspirv_instruction_builder_autogen.cpp376 void WriteTypeStruct(Blob *blob, IdResult idResult, const IdRefList &memberList) in WriteTypeStruct() argument
381 for (const auto &operand : memberList) in WriteTypeStruct()
/third_party/glslang/glslang/HLSL/
H A DhlslParseHelper.cpp1577 auto& memberList = flattenMap[variable.getUniqueId()].members; in assignToInterface() local
1578 for (auto member = memberList.begin(); member != memberList.end(); ++member) in assignToInterface()

Completed in 46 milliseconds